How it works

  1. Introduction & Safety: We start with a brief history of street art and a vital safety briefing on how to use the equipment properly.
  2. Concept Sketching: Students grab paper and pencils to brainstorm their tags and designs, learning about letter structure and flow.
  3. Can Control: Before hitting the wall, we teach the basics—nozzles, pressure, and how to get those clean lines without the drips.
  4. Outline & Fill: This is where the magic happens! Students start sketching their designs onto the wall or canvas and filling them with vibrant colours.
  5. Advanced Techniques: Our pros show the kids how to add shadows, 3D effects, and highlights to make their work pop.
  6. The 'Final Touch': We go over the piece one last time for sharpening edges and adding those "power lines" that define great graffiti.
  7. Group Review: We step back, admire the collective masterpiece, and discuss what everyone learned during the creative process.
  8. Clean Up: We ensure the site is left spotless, packing away all materials and gear so the school day can continue as normal.
